Reid Carruthers (Winnipeg, MB) finished 3-1 in the 32-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, Carruthers defeated
Shaun Parsons (Thompson, MB) 12-1, then won 9-2 against Randy Neufeld (LaSalle, MB). Carruthers went on to lose 9-7 against Scott Ramsay (Winnipeg, MB). Carruthers responded with a 6-5 win over Hayden Forrester (Winnipeg, MB) in their final qualifying round match.
 
Carruthers earned 18.217 world rankings points for their Top 3 finish in the Manitoba Viterra Championship. For week 26 of the event schedule, Carruthers did not improve upon their best events, remaining at 5th place on the World Ranking Standings with 637.968 total points. Carruthers ranks 4th overall on the Year-to-Date rankings with 353.508 points earned so far this season.
